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Sr. Algorithms Engineer, Autobidder

$140k - $312k

Tesla

What To Expect The mission of the Autobidder team is to accelerate the world's transition to sustainable energy by maximizing the value of storage and renewable assets. We achieve this by building state-of-the-art software products for monetizing front-of-the-meter and behind-the-meter energy storage systems. Our flagship product, Autobidder, is an end-to-end automation suite for wholesale electricity market participation of grid-connected batteries and renewable resources that maximizes revenues by optimally bidding in all available revenue streams in these markets. We are a multidisciplinary algorithmic trading team with expertise in machine learning, numerical optimization, software engineering, distributed systems, electricity markets, and trading. We have a proven track record of operating storage assets and delivering high revenues in both utility-scale and Virtual Power Plant (VPP) settings. Our products are contracted to manage over 7GWh of energy storage worldwide and have returned over $420 million in trading profits, and we're slated for rapid growth on the horizon. What You'll Do Algorithm Development: Design, implement, and maintain production code for sophisticated bidding, optimization, simulation, and forecasting algorithms Research and Innovation: Prototype, benchmark, deploy and monitor advanced algorithmic features that account for uncertainties in prices and clearing outcomes, optimally allocate quantities to maximize risk adjusted revenues, reason about interactions with strategic competitors, account for influence of quantity on clearing prices, etc. for large fleets of utility-scale storage assets and VPPs Domain Expertise: Become an expert in electricity markets and grid, and the various facets of operating in them Technical Leadership: Guide algorithmic decisions to balance performance and complexity and make thoughtful design and infrastructure choices that facilitate a positive developer experience in the long run Tooling and Simulation: Develop tooling and simulation systems to monitor and track field performance of assets. Define metrics to quantify, track, and improve specific areas of performance, and drive algorithm changes to enhance asset performance under management Cross-Functional Collaboration: Work with ML engineers, traders, market analysts, and software engineers to ensure algorithms drive end-to-end value What You'll Bring Proficiency in Python with at least 4 years of experience in software development, familiarity with software development practices, writing production-quality code, and agile development Experience in building real-world products and solutions using numerical optimization technology (LP, MILP, nonlinear optimization, etc.) and solving real-world optimization problems using solvers such as Gurobi, XPRESS, GLPK, CPLEX, etc. Expertise with relevant Python libraries such as cvxpy, pyomo, pandas, numpy, sklearn, streamlit, and more Demonstrated experience in developing and maintaining production software Self-motivation, enthusiasm for learning and collaboration, and a passion for working in the clean energy space Prefer experience building security constrained economic dispatch, unit commitment, or power flow models for real-world financial decision making Strong preference for domain expertise in forecasting, analysis, or trading in electricity markets (e.g., ISOs like ERCOT, CAISO, PJM, AEMO, UK National Grid) Prefer academic training in numerical optimization, operations research, stochastic control, optimal control, computational finance, and related mathematical fields Prefer prior experience in researching, developing, and deploying new algorithmic strategies to solve novel optimization problems, eg. decision-making under uncertainty, scenario optimization, MDPs, financial risk modeling, complementarity problems, etc. Prefer familiarity with a range of machine learning and statistical algorithms, including gradient-boosted decision trees, the ARIMA family, transformers, recurrent networks, etc. Benefits Medical plans with $0 payroll deduction Family-building, fertility, adoption and surrogacy benefits Dental (including orthodontic coverage) and vision plans, both with options with a $0 paycheck contribution Company Paid HSA Contribution when enrolled in the High-Deductible medical plan with HSA Healthcare and Dependent Care Flexible Spending Accounts (FSA) 401(k) with employer match, Employee Stock Purchase Plans, and other financial benefits Company paid Basic Life, AD&D Short-term and long-term disability insurance (90 day waiting period) Employee Assistance Program Sick and Vacation time (Flex time for salary positions, Accrued hours for Hourly positions), and Paid Holidays Back-up childcare and parenting support resources Voluntary benefits including critical illness, hospital indemnity, accident insurance, theft & legal services, and pet insurance Weight Loss and Tobacco Cessation Programs Tesla Babies program Commuter benefits Employee discounts and perks program Compensation and Benefits Expected Compensation: $140,000 - $312,000 annual salary + cash and stock awards + benefits. Pay offered may vary depending on multiple individualized factors, including market location, job-related knowledge, skills, and experience. The total compensation package for this position may also include other elements dependent on the position offered. Details of participation in these benefit plans will be provided if an employee receives an offer of employment. – Tesla #J-18808-Ljbffr Tesla

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Sr. Algorithms Engineer, Autobidder in Palo Alto, CA vacancy
  • Tesla is seeking an experienced algorithm developer to join the Autobidder team, which is dedicated to renewable energy. This role involves designing and maintaining production-level code for sophisticated bidding and optimization algorithms aimed at maximizing revenues... 
    Senior

    Tesla

    Palo Alto, CA
    2 days ago
  • $140k - $312k

     ...energy technology company based in Palo Alto seeks an experienced software developer to join their Autobidder team. The candidate will design and implement sophisticated algorithms for optimizing energy storage systems and participate in revolutionizing energy markets.... 
    Senior

    Tesla Motors, Inc.

    Palo Alto, CA
    2 days ago
  •  ...ensuring a high level of customer experience. The ideal candidate must have a BS degree in Electrical Engineering or a related field and 3+ years of experience in BMS algorithm development. Exceptional communication and leadership skills are essential. #J-18808-Ljbffr... 
    Senior

    Apple

    Cupertino, CA
    3 days ago
  • $125k - $201.25k

     ...: Robotics & Digital Solutions, part of the Johnson & Johnson family of companies, is recruiting for a Senior Robotic Algorithms and Controls Engineer This position is located in Santa Clara, CA. At J&J Robotics we're changing the trajectory of health for humanity, using... 
    Senior
    Local area
    Immediate start
    Flexible hours

    Johnson & Johnson

    Santa Clara, CA
    1 day ago
  • $152k - $241.5k

    We are looking for a Senior DL Algorithms Engineer for LLM/Omni model optimizations! Seeking senior engineers who are mindful of performance analysis and optimization to help us squeeze every last clock cycle out of Deep Learning workloads. If you are unafraid to work across... 
    Senior

    NVIDIA

    Santa Clara, CA
    1 day ago
  • $150k - $190k

     ...Job Description Job Description Location Algorithm Engineer Location: Belmont, CA (hybrid) Employees : Industry : Wireless services Position Reporting To: Principal Engineer Dynamic Bay Area startup is seeking a Wireless Location Algorithm Engineer... 
    Senior
    Shift work

    Cypress HCM

    Redwood City, CA
    6 days ago
  • $170k - $225k

    A technology company in Redwood City is seeking a Senior/Staff Algorithms Engineer to tackle challenges in robot task and action planning. The role involves developing and optimizing algorithms using techniques from machine learning, optimization, and more. Candidates should... 
    Senior

    Blackhornvc

    Redwood City, CA
    12 hours ago
  • $161k - $221k

    A leading technology company in Santa Clara seeks an experienced Algorithm Developer specializing in Image Processing and Machine Learning. You will create and implement advanced algorithms to support semiconductor process development. Ideal candidates have a Master's or... 
    Senior

    Applied Materials, Inc.

    Santa Clara, CA
    12 hours ago
  • $180k - $240k

     ...Sr. Computer Vision Engineer (Deep Learning) Mountain View, CA Harbinger is an American commercial electric vehicle (EV) company on a mission...  ..., addressing issues, and refining architecture and algorithms. Perform detailed root cause analysis of production issues... 
    Senior
    Local area

    Harbinger

    Mountain View, CA
    1 day ago
  • $181.3k - $245.3k

     ...A leading technology firm in Mountain View seeks a Senior Perception Engineer to advance autonomous driving via innovative 4D perception algorithms. Candidates should have 3+ years of experience in real-time perception systems, a MS or PhD in relevant fields, and proficiency... 
    Senior
    Flexible hours

    Aeva, Inc

    Mountain View, CA
    2 days ago
  • $180k - $240k

     ...Foundation. We are seeking a highly skilled Senior Deep Learning Engineer to drive the development and deployment of advanced perception...  ...performance, addressing issues, and refining architecture and algorithms. Perform detailed root cause analysis of production issues... 
    Senior
    Contract work
    Local area

    Harbinger Motors Inc.

    Mountain View, CA
    2 days ago
  • $185k - $230k

     ...planet. We are a team of mission-driven engineers with experience across aerospace, robotics...  ...to make this future a reality. As a Sr. Flight Software Verification Engineer...  ...links together the mechanical, avionics, algorithmic, and embedded worlds to actually make the... 
    Senior
    Permanent employment

    Reliable Robotics Corporation

    Mountain View, CA
    2 days ago
  • $152k - $228k

     ...technology company located in Mountain View is seeking a Senior Software Engineer to enhance their routing systems. The role involves building backend applications, optimizing routing algorithms, and collaborating with product teams. Ideal candidates should have extensive... 
    Senior

    Nuro

    Mountain View, CA
    2 days ago
  • $198k - $326k

     ...As part of our world-class software engineering team, you will take the lead in building...  ...passion for distributed technologies and algorithms, API design and systems design, and your...  ...real impact within our company. As a Sr. Staff Software Engineer, you will be a... 
    Senior
    For contractors
    Work at office
    Flexible hours

    LinkedIn

    Mountain View, CA
    12 hours ago
  • $100k

     ...Sr. Engineer, Ethernet IP Santa Clara, California, United States; Vancouver, British Columbia, Canada Tenstorrent is leading the...  ...subsystems in the lab. Implement and optimize link-training algorithms and auto-negotiation protocols. Work closely with silicon... 
    Senior
    Permanent employment

    Tenstorrent

    Santa Clara, CA
    1 day ago
  •  ...Alto Employment Type Full time Location Type On-site Department Engineering Ricursive Intelligence is a frontier AI Lab focused on...  ...class engineers and researchers to build next‑generation EDA algorithms across synthesis, placement & routing, PPA optimization, timing... 
    Full time

    Ricursive Intelligence

    Palo Alto, CA
    1 day ago
  •  ...efficient. ALSO is looking for a Senior Staff Vehicle Controls Engineer to lead the design and development of world-class vehicle...  ...technical leadership across control architecture, estimation, and algorithm development, helping shape next-generation vehicle control... 
    Senior
    Local area
    Flexible hours

    ALSO

    Palo Alto, CA
    4 days ago
  •  ...objectives. Be the first line of defense in solving customer support requests and coordinating and prioritizing timely resolutions with engineering teams. Provide training and coaching to customers on how to establish and manage their Xage Security solutions deployment.... 
    Senior

    Xage

    Palo Alto, CA
    2 days ago
  •  ...support the company’s technology. Bachelor’s degree in Electrical Engineering or Computer Science from a leading University. GPA > 3.5....  ...Job Description Implementing cutting edge image processing algorithms on mobile platforms (Android + iOS). Optimizing solution for... 
    Overseas

    Optiz Inc.

    Palo Alto, CA
    1 day ago
  •  ...levels of accuracy, coverage, and responsiveness to power critical insights precisely where they’re needed most. As a Radar Algorithms Engineer you will develop, deploy, and scale innovative 3D reconstruction algorithms and processing techniques for this unique radar imaging... 
    Permanent employment

    Array Labs

    Palo Alto, CA
    3 days ago
  • Wing is seeking a Navigation Engineer to join their Guidance, Navigation, and Control team in Palo Alto, CA or remotely within the United...  ...systems, focusing on developing reliable advanced autonomy algorithms. Candidates should have a strong background in multi-sensor... 
    Senior
    Remote work

    Wing

    Palo Alto, CA
    3 days ago
  • $180k - $240k

    Vinci4D.ai in Palo Alto is seeking a Geometry / Meshing Engineer to help design and optimize systems for their next-generation copilot...  ...engineering skills in C++ or Python and experience in algorithm design. A competitive compensation range of $180K to $240K is... 
    Senior

    Vinci4D.ai

    Palo Alto, CA
    12 hours ago
  • $124k - $206k

     ...Please review the job details below. Lanteris Space Systems is seeking an experienced Identity and Access Management (IAM) Engineer to lead the transition and ongoing management of our enterprise IAM program. This role can be based remotely in the US. This position... 
    Senior
    Remote work
    Shift work

    Lanteris Space Systems

    Palo Alto, CA
    4 days ago
  • $181.3k - $245.3k

     ...robots to make more intelligent and safe decisions. Role overview: We are looking for a Senior Perception Engineer to work on our classical perception algorithms stack. You will be part of a growing team focused on exploring how far Aeva’s 4D FMCW LiDARs can push... 
    Senior
    Flexible hours

    Aeva, Inc

    Mountain View, CA
    5 days ago
  • $215k - $300k

     ...planet. We are a team of mission-driven engineers with experience across aerospace, robotics...  ...working to make this future a reality. As a Sr. FPGA Design Engineer at Reliable...  ...implementing, and verifying fixed point DSP algorithms Comfortable with a fast-paced, agile... 
    Senior
    Permanent employment

    Reliable Robotics Corporation

    Mountain View, CA
    2 days ago
  • $154k - $192k

     ...shares a love of the outdoors and a desire to protect it for future generations. Role Summary In this role, the hardware design engineer will own electrical system design, bring-up, and validation for the current and next generation of Rivian electric vehicles.... 
    Senior
    Full time
    Contract work
    Temporary work
    Part time
    Local area
    Shift work

    Rivian

    Palo Alto, CA
    4 days ago
  • $140k - $300k

    What to Expect Tesla Energy is looking for an Embedded Software Engineer to help contribute to next generation designs. This role...  ...Expert software fundamentals including architectural design, algorithm development, data structures, code modularity, and maintainability... 
    Senior
    Hourly pay
    Full time
    Temporary work
    Flexible hours

    Tesla Motors, Inc.

    Palo Alto, CA
    1 day ago
  •  ...will do everything from low‑level SPICE simulations to top‑level algorithm development in Python and SystemVerilog/RNM, all while...  ...Strength in Linux (reasonable ability to debug) Automotive or other High‑Reliability engineering experience #J-18808-Ljbffr Mythic, Inc.
    Senior

    Mythic, Inc.

    Palo Alto, CA
    4 days ago
  • $140k - $300k

     ...capability of Tesla’s in-house traffic prediction and routing algorithms that serve our customer cars today and will serve our future Robotaxis...  ...experience Collaborate with Tesla Navigation Software Engineers to implement, validate and deploy these algorithms at scale... 
    Hourly pay
    Temporary work
    Flexible hours

    Tesla

    Palo Alto, CA
    1 day ago
  • $180k - $260k

     ...people — move around the planet. We are a team of mission-driven engineers with experience across aerospace, robotics and self-driving...  ...analyzing phased array radar systems and developing radar processing algorithms to enable short, long range object tracking, and radar image... 
    Permanent employment
    Casual work
    Remote work

    Reliable Robotics Corporation

    Mountain View, CA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Sr. Algorithms Engineer, Autobidder. Be the first to apply!